In one line

  • Garden City Union Free School District spends 8% more per student than Montgomery Township School District after adjusting for local price levels.
  • Garden City Union Free School District directs 8 more cents of every operating dollar to instruction than Montgomery Township School District.
  • Garden City Union Free School District is far more dependent on local property taxes (88% of revenue vs 73%), which ties its budget more tightly to local property values.

How NJ funds its districts

School Funding Reform Act (SFRA): an adequacy budget per district with a local fair share subtracted.

How NY funds its districts

Foundation Aid: a per-pupil formula weighted for regional cost and student need, layered over a heavily local property-tax base.

Results, and results for the money

Deliberately not shown.Not shown, and cannot honestly be shown across state lines. NJ and NY set their own tests and their own passing marks, so "% proficient" in one is not the same measurement as "% proficient" in the other. Sites that compare them anyway are comparing two different rulers.
